Domanda

Ho modificato la mia configurazione MOSS 2007 per interrogare un determinato obiettivo dC con successo. Vorrei mostrare alcuni campi LDAP personalizzata (ad esempio paese) nel controllo PeopleEditor e consentire agli utenti di cercare nei confronti di questi campi. Qualcuno mi può puntare verso le risorse utili / tutorial che mostrano come fare questo?

Grazie, MagicAndi.

È stato utile?

Soluzione

È necessario ereditare dal controllo EntityEditor (proprio come fa PeopleEditor) e scrivere i propri query e convalida.

Alcuni di fondo (leggere il contenuto di comunità):

Oltre a questi collegamenti e studiando con attenzione il controllo PeopleEditor con riflettore, un'altra buona risorsa è questo post del blog da Igor Kozlov . C'è un su MSDN qui .

Sto lavorando su un progetto CodePlex che interroga un dato Active Directory da un selettore di persone. E 'ben documentato e combina le tecniche dei vari riferimenti sul web (dando credito ovviamente). Speranza che aiuta qualcuno, come pure!

Altri suggerimenti

Un primo passo dovrebbe essere quello di mappare i campi formano l'annuncio a un attributo nel profilo utente di SharePoint. È possibile farlo nella configurazione del provider Share Service (Amministrazione centrale> Shared Services> Profili utente e proprietà).

Ci si aggiunge un nuovo attributo e definire quale campo annuncio dovrebbe essere mappata ad esso. È inoltre possibile definire quali campi gli utenti sono autorizzati a ignorare (ma solo in SharePoint, è solo una sincronizzazione uno modi) e che si sono di sola lettura.

post sul blog mostra come configurare la ricerca di SharePoint per essere in grado di cercare per gli utenti un attributo personalizzato nel profilo utente.

Spero che questo vi punto nella giusta direzione.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top